SYNOPSIS
INTEGER FUNCTION IEEECK( ISPEC, ZERO, ONE )
INTEGER ISPEC
REAL ONE, ZERO
PURPOSE
IEEECK is called from the ILAENV to verify that Infinity and possibly
NaN arithmetic is safe (i.e. will not trap).
ARGUMENTS
ISPEC (input) INTEGER
Specifies whether to test just for inifinity arithmetic or
whether to test for infinity and NaN arithmetic. = 0: Verify
infinity arithmetic only.
= 1: Verify infinity and NaN arithmetic.
ZERO (input) REAL
Must contain the value 0.0 This is passed to prevent the com‐
piler from optimizing away this code.
ONE (input) REAL
Must contain the value 1.0 This is passed to prevent the com‐
piler from optimizing away this code. RETURN VALUE: INTEGER =
0: Arithmetic failed to produce the correct answers
= 1: Arithmetic produced the correct answers Return if we were
only asked to check infinity arithmetic
